Voyage 1 Red Schooner

Tim L
9.1

Caymus-Wagoner family signature on this fine wine with Australian grapes and Caymus California wine-making. Blend of Grenache, Shiraz and other grapes of Australia, shipped to U.S. in chilled containers, reportedly maintaining freshness…aged in French Oak, bottled in 2018 - vintage is simply Red Schooner 1. In any event, the process produced a rich, full-bodied, big fruit but balanced wine with managed tannins…many attributes…better than several of Caymus own labeled wines. — 5 months ago

Wagner Vineyards

Ice Finger Lakes Riesling 2018

Golden hue. Plus body and medium acidity. Aromas and flavors of apricot, golden raisins, honey, marmalade, and orange. Jammy and sweet, like orange soda without the fizz. Absurdly drinkable. — 5 months ago

Belle Glos

Clark & Telephone Vineyard Pinot Noir 2021

Crafted by Joseph J. Wagner, 4th generation winemaker, with winemaking roots in the Napa Valley since 1906. Deep Ruby with red berry fruit aromas, tea and sweet spice notes. On the palate flavors of jammy blackberry and cherry with pronounced sweet vanilla oak, cacao and pepper spice notes. Soft tannins and bright acidity, well balanced, with mineral tones on a long finish ending with toasty spice! Nice! — 21 days ago
